 WHEREAS, Williams Family Farms was named the 2023 High Cotton
 Award winner for the Southwest by Farm Press and the Cotton
 Foundation; and
 WHEREAS, Established in 1995, the High Cotton Awards
 recognize outstanding cotton producers across the country who use
 regenerative and sustainable practices and who demonstrate genuine
 concern for the environment through the dedicated stewardship of
 their land; and
 WHEREAS, Williams Family Farms is a family operation that
 includes Mark and Joyce Williams and their three sons, Ryan and his
 wife, Annie, Russell and his wife, Julie, and Reagan; the family has
 grown cotton near Farwell for four generations, and within the last
 decade, the Williamses have expanded their operation 150 miles
 north to Dalhart, where they currently produce cotton, corn, wheat,
 and sorghum on roughly 18,000 acres; and
 WHEREAS, Recognized for its high quality cotton and
 consistent yields, Williams Family Farms emphasizes the importance
 of water, timeliness, and variety in its production process; the
 Williamses are currently converting their irrigated acres from
 30-inch rows to 40-inch rows in order to help conserve moisture and
 manage irrigation, and they rotate and halve fields depending on
 water availability; in addition, they employ a no-till cotton
 production method on most of their farmland, take soil samples,
 fertilize primarily with manure, and participate in field trials;
 and
 WHEREAS, Williams Family Farms has achieved noteworthy
 success within its industry, and this prestigious accolade is a
 testament to the family's enduring commitment to cotton production
 and to the environment as a whole; now, therefore, be it
